ClamXav

Paul Westbrook | 22 August, 2005 21:28

I use ClamAV on my mail server, but I really haven't tried out ClamXav.  ClamXav is a Mac OS X wrapper around ClamAV.  It provides a way o manually scan folders as well it will automatically scan certain folders.  For example, it can automatically scan your download and mail folders.

The MacDevCenter has a good article on setting up ClamXav.  At the end of the article, there is an interview with the developer.
